Turing has an employee rating of 3.6 out of 5 stars, based on 748 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Turing employ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.9 stars).

Hi, I am Radhika and I am from Indore, India. I have been working as a technical content writer at Turing.com for the past 1.5 months. My job is to write content related to different verticals. Pros: Flexibility to choose my working hours. I am able to take out time for my family which was not possible earlier when I had to commute to the office daily for a 9-5 job. A great work-life balance. The team understands your personal space. Amazing work culture. If you are a job seeker, you should definitely join Turing and you’ll forget about your 9-5 job.

Cons

I haven't faced any problems so far.

Flexibility: Turing lets you choose your own working hours. And I really enjoy the complete remote work culture which allows me to take out time for my friends and family. Great workplace: People here at Turing are always welcoming, ready to help, and very nice. Being spread across the world, the team is diverse and I like to meet new people.

Cons

Found none, so far !
